The Quick Decision Loop: Bet, Step, Cash Out
The heartbeat of Chicken Road lies in its decision loop. You start by setting a stake—sometimes as low as €0.01—and then watch the chicken take its first step onto the road. After each successful step, the multiplier jumps, and you face a choice: keep going or lock in your earnings.
This loop is repeated until either you cash out or the chicken meets an unexpected obstacle. For players who thrive on rapid action, this loop feels like a series of quick choices that keep the mind engaged without lingering on long narratives.
Because the stakes rise with every step, you’re constantly balancing hunger for higher multipliers against the risk of losing everything if the chicken takes a wrong turn.
Choosing the Right Difficulty for Rapid Play
The game offers four difficulty levels—Easy, Medium, Hard, and Hardcore—each with a different number of steps and risk profile. For those who prefer short, intense bursts of action, selecting a level that offers fast payouts is key.
Below is a quick reference for picking the right mode when you’re on a tight schedule:
- Easy (24 steps): Low risk, frequent small wins—great as a warm‑up.
- Medium (22 steps): Balanced risk and reward—ideal for mid‑day play.
- Hard (20 steps): Higher multipliers but sharper danger—best for experienced players.
- Hardcore (15 steps): The most intense; chances of loss per step are highest—suitable only for short bursts if you’re comfortable with higher volatility.
Short‑session gamers often pick Medium or Hard because they hit that sweet spot where the game remains exciting but still offers a realistic chance of walking away with a decent win before the next break.
